November 13–15, 2026 | Tokyo, Japan
The Classical Pilates Conference in Tokyo brings together the global Pilates community for three days dedicated to the tradition and lineage of the Pilats method. Centered on the complete system, the event explores the work, the order, the apparatus, and the philosophy that define Classical Pilates.
Through hands-on sessions led by internationally recognized instructors and practiced on Gratz apparatus, attendees will deepen their understanding and refine their practice within the full expression of the work.

Featured Classical Pilates Instructors
Learn from a distinguished group of internationally respected teachers, each bringing a deep commitment to the tradition, precision, and continued evolution of the Classical Pilates method.
A leading second-generation Classical Pilates teacher trained by Romana Kryzanowska, Mejo Wiggin is internationally recognized for her work as a master teacher trainer, known for her precise, hands-on approach and decades of experience educating instructors worldwide.
Director of the Escuela Española de Auténtico Pilates, Fabien Menegon is a highly respected teacher trainer with over 20 years of experience, known for evolving Pilates education while preserving the integrity and precision of the original method.
A longtime Classical Pilates instructor and graduate of Jay Grimes’ prestigious THE WORK™, Ken Krech brings a deep, lineage-based understanding of the method, blending decades of teaching with a background in athletic performance and bodywork.
A dedicated Classical Pilates teacher and educator, KyungHye Sinclair is recognized for her commitment to preserving the original method and sharing its depth through international teaching and mentorship within the global Pilates community.
